Patch Management Tools: These tools are used to manage the patching process of the operating system, software applications, and firmware in the server infrastructure. They provide a centralized management console to deploy patches across multiple servers, schedule automated patching, and track patching progress. Some examples of patch management tools are Microsoft System Center Configuration Manager (SCCM), IBM BigFix, and SolarWinds Patch Manager.

Monitoring and Alerting Tools: These tools are used to monitor the health of servers, network devices, and applications in real-time. They provide notifications and alerts when a system is down or not responding, enabling administrators to take proactive action to resolve the issue. They can also help in identifying potential security threats and providing insights into system performance. Some examples of monitoring and alerting tools are Nagios, PRTG Network Monitor, and SolarWinds Network Performance Monitor.
